T/T Payment Speed Benefits: Why Funds Move So Quickly

Unlike checks that can take weeks to clear, a t/t payment usually settles within one to three business days. The sending bank then transmits a secure message, traditionally via the SWIFT network, to instruct the recipient bank to credit the specified amount to the beneficiary account.
